16. Conservation Laws, Numerical Schemes and Control Strategies for Sedimentation and Wastewater Treatment
Sammanfattning : A consistent theme throughout this thesis is quasilinear partial differential equations (PDEs) appearing in one-dimensional models of sedimentation for solid-liquid separation of suspensions. 20. Design and analysis of a novel low loss homopolar electrodynamic bearing
Sammanfattning : A novel homopolar electrodynamic bearing, together with a suitable permanent magnet drive, have been developed for high-speed applications where low losses and high reliability are essential and exclude the use of ball bearings, and yet where active magnetic bearings offer a too complex system solution. Considered applications are small turbomolecular vacuum pumps, and maintenance free flywheels for energy storage in remote telecom and satellite systems. LÄS MER
